Is the USB cable connected to the computer properly ? If the USB cable is connected properly and is not recognized, connect to another USB port of the computer.
Disconnect the USB cable, then restart the computer and reconnect the camcorder with the computer in the correct procedure.
Disconnect any USB devices other than the camcorder, keyboard, and mouse.
If the camcorder is connected via a USB hub, connect the camcorder directly to the computer.
If any resident software is installed, exit and connect the camcorder.

To play back an AVCHD disc, you need a compliant DVD player.
Check if your player supports AVCHD standard.
Use "Everio MediaBrowser™ 3 Player" when playing back on a computer.
Be careful not to insert an AVCHD disc to a non-compliant player.
It may cause a malfunction.
If the disc contains SD quality (4:3) videos, the appropriate aspect ratio may not be reproduced depending on the player.
It is recommended to create a DVD-Video if appropriate aspect ratio is not reproduced on other players.

If you installed security software, the connection between Everio MediaBrowser™ 3 and the Web site may be blocked. Allow Everio MediaBrowser™ 3 to access to the internet in this case.
Contact the security software maker for how to allow specified software to access to the Internet.

If you replaced the memory card after the files are displayed on the Browser screen, it will take a long time to read the information of the replaced card.
Be careful not to replace the cards while Everio MediaBrowser™ 3 is working on the files.
"PixelaTemporaryFiles" is a temporary folder which is created in the destination when exporting to iTunes®.
This folder is usually deleted automatically upon the completion of exporting.
Delete the folder manually if it remains after exiting the software.
